BYU’s Mika, Bryant Honored

(Provo, UT) — BYU’s Eric Mika is the NCAA.com Player of the Week. Mika also took home Lute Olson Award National Player of the Week honors after posting 29 points and 11 rebounds in Saturday’s win over previously-unbeaten Gonzaga. Meanwhile, teammate Elijah Bryant was named WCC Player of the Week.

Jazz Take On Thunder

(Oklahoma City, OK) — The Jazz take on Russell Westbrook and the Thunder in Oklahoma City tonight. Utah ran its winning streak to three games with a 102-92 victory over the Wizards on Sunday. The Jazz also improved to 37-and-22 with the win. OKC is 34-and-25.
